If there’s anything that gets my attention, it’s free food. You’d think as much as I like to eat that I might weigh a lot more, but really I do love good food.  Most of the time, I prefer my food to be fresh ingredients, cooked at home with simple fare and tasty herbs.  But, sometimes as we all know, time gets in the way and you just have to take shortcuts some days in order to get something in that tummy.

I don’t buy a lot of frozen meals, but have been known to get by on these when there is just no time to cook.  The fine folks at Zatarain’s recently sent me some freebie coupons to try out their new frozen entrees.  You know they are known for tasty dishes and spicy Cajun flavor and these meals don’t disappoint. Heat and eat, can’t get any easier than that!

I popped into my local Publix to see what they had and picked up 3 different varieties (some I got more than one) and these are the ones that looked good to me and my taste buds.

I’ve already tried the Chicken Alfredo and the Chicken with Yellow Rice and both were equally tasty.  Zatarain’s is known for their flavorful foods and these live up to the spicy, tasty standards that you normally think of when you hear the name Zatarain’s.
